索引漏洞驱动的后端搜索性能优化方案
|
在现代Web应用中,后端搜索性能直接影响用户体验和系统稳定性。当用户输入查询时,后端需要快速响应并返回准确结果。然而,随着数据量的增加,简单的全表扫描会导致查询效率低下,进而引发性能瓶颈。 索引是提升数据库查询效率的关键手段。通过为常用查询字段建立索引,可以大幅减少数据库扫描的数据量,从而加快搜索速度。但索引并非万能,不当的索引设计反而会增加写入开销,影响整体性能。 在实际应用中,许多开发者忽略了对搜索条件的分析,导致索引未被有效利用。例如,某些查询可能包含多个条件,而索引只覆盖了部分字段,这使得数据库无法使用最优的索引策略。 为了优化搜索性能,应结合业务场景进行索引设计。对于高频搜索字段,如用户名、商品名称等,应优先建立复合索引。同时,避免过度索引,确保每个索引都有明确的使用场景。
本图基于AI算法,仅供参考 定期分析查询日志,识别慢查询并进行优化,也是提升性能的重要步骤。通过工具监控索引使用情况,可以及时发现无效或低效的索引,并进行调整。在某些复杂查询场景下,还可以考虑使用缓存机制,将频繁访问的结果缓存起来,减少直接访问数据库的次数。这不仅能提升响应速度,还能降低数据库负载。 站长个人见解,索引漏洞往往隐藏在不合理的查询设计和索引配置中。通过系统性地分析和优化,可以显著提升后端搜索的性能,为用户提供更流畅的体验。 (编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

